ISO/IEC 9075-2:2016/Cor 1:2019是数据库语言SQL的一部分,即SQL基础部分。SQL是一种用于管理关系型数据库的语言,它可以用于创建、修改和查询数据库中的数据。SQL是一种标准化的语言,由国际标准化组织(ISO)和国际电工委员会(IEC)共同制定和维护。
ISO/IEC 9075-2:2016/Cor 1:2019规定了SQL的基本结构、数据类型、操作符、函数、谓词、表达式、查询、事务和约束等方面的内容。其中,SQL的基本结构包括SQL语句的组成部分、SQL语句的分类和SQL语句的执行顺序等。SQL的数据类型包括数值类型、字符类型、日期时间类型、二进制类型和其他类型等。SQL的操作符包括算术操作符、比较操作符、逻辑操作符和位操作符等。SQL的函数包括数学函数、字符串函数、日期时间函数和其他函数等。SQL的谓词包括比较谓词、逻辑谓词和位谓词等。SQL的表达式包括算术表达式、字符串表达式、日期时间表达式和其他表达式等。SQL的查询包括SELECT语句、FROM子句、WHERE子句、GROUP BY子句、HAVING子句和ORDER BY子句等。SQL的事务包括事务的概念、事务的特性、事务的隔离级别和事务的控制等。SQL的约束包括主键约束、唯一约束、检查约束和外键约束等。
此外,ISO/IEC 9075-2:2016/Cor 1:2019还规定了SQL的语法和语义,以及SQL的实现应该满足的最小要求。SQL的语法包括SQL语句的书写规则、SQL语句的关键字和标识符等。SQL的语义包括SQL语句的含义、SQL语句的执行结果和SQL语句的正确性等。SQL的实现应该满足的最小要求包括SQL的数据类型、SQL的操作符、SQL的函数、SQL的谓词、SQL的表达式、SQL的查询、SQL的事务和SQL的约束等方面的要求。
总之,ISO/IEC 9075-2:2016/Cor 1:2019是SQL基础部分的技术勘误,它规定了SQL的基本结构、数据类型、操作符、函数、谓词、表达式、查询、事务和约束等方面的内容,以及SQL的语法和语义,以及SQL的实现应该满足的最小要求。
相关标准
- ISO/IEC 9075-1:2016/Cor 1:2019
- ISO/IEC 9075-3:2016/Cor 1:2019
- ISO/IEC 9075-4:2016/Cor 1:2019
- ISO/IEC 9075-9:2016/Cor 1:2019
- ISO/IEC 9075-10:2016/Cor 1:2019